Are you an alumni if you drop out?

The term alumnus/alumna refers to anyone who attended a particular university (Merriam-Webster definition). Use graduate or dropout (or non-graduate alumnus) to specify whether or not someone completed a degree. Many tech company founders dropped out of college, but are still considered alumni.

Which ethnicity has the highest dropout rate?

In 2019, the high school drop out rate for American Indian/Alaska Natives in the United States was 9.6 percent — the highest rate of any ethnicity. In comparison, the high school drop out rate for Asians was just under two percent.

How much are the most famous college dropouts worth?

Check out this list for the full number of some of the most famous college dropouts. The combined net worth of the most famous dropouts is USD 246 billion. The average net worth of billionaires who dropped out of college, $9.4 billion, is approximately triple that of billionaires with Ph.D.s, $3.2 billion.
